What Makes You a Great Fit

We are looking for a highly skilled and motivated Manager to join our Product Operations team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for designing, building, and scaling innovative approaches that enhance our product lifecycle, from intake to prioritization and product launch.

You will work closely with cross-functional teams to deliver impactful product initiatives and operational improvements, with a particular focus on identifying opportunities to automate internal processes, scale AI usage, and improve how teams operate across Product, Engineering, Operations, and go-to-market functions.

This role reports to the Director, Product Operations. For this role, we are primarily looking for candidates based in the Bay Area who can collaborate in person 3 days per week.

 
 
How You'll Make an Impact
  • Collaborate with Product Management, Engineering, Operations and cross-functional teams to build and deliver scalable, high-quality solutions

  • Be the voice of customer to inform product development in a data-driven approach

  • Optimize processes, dashboards and cadence to drive input collection, prioritize product development and land products

  • Identify, design, and implement AI-enabled workflows and automation to reduce manual work, improve operating efficiency, and scale internal processes

  • Lead by example in writing clean, maintainable, and efficient documentation and process flows

  • Serve as a key partner to Product Managers, providing operational insights and support throughout the product lifecycle

  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ives to enhance product operations and overall business performance

  • Lead special cross-functional projects in unexplored areas, including opportunities to apply AI and automation to improve how teams work

Let’s Connect If You Have:
  • Bachelor's degree in a relevant field or equivalent practical experience

  • Typically 5-7 years of professional experience in Product Operations, Management Consulting, or a related field within a technology company

  • Experience with product lifecycle management, agile methodologies, and data analysis tools

  • Hands-on experience using AI tools and automation to improve internal processes, reduce manual work, or scale operational workflows

  • Ability to identify high-impact automation opportunities, translate ambiguous operational problems into structured workflows, and partner with technical and non-technical teams to implement solutions

  • Experience driving change management across cross-functional teams, including enabling adoption of new processes, tools, or ways of working

  •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ic work environment

  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ills with a customer-centric and leadership mindset

What We Do

Pebl puts a world of talent at your fingertips. With our Global Work Platform™, companies can hire, pay, and manage employees in 185+ countries—removing risk, red tape, and guesswork from global growth. Backed by more than a decade of local expertise and compliance leadership, Pebl is built to move as fast as your ambitions, whether you’re bringing on your first international teammate or scaling a workforce across continents. Our AI-powered, human-led platform integrates seamlessly with HRIS, HCM, and ATS systems and delivers instant, vetted answers in 50+ languages—so you stay compliant and confident wherever you grow. We’ve helped thousands of businesses—from Fortune 500s to rapid-growth start-ups—scale strategically around the world. Consistently named a leader in global Employer of Record (EOR) services, Pebl holds more employment licenses than any other EOR and is rated #1 for compliance on G2. With Pebl, companies everywhere can hire great talent anywhere.
